Transaction 01020c1d94ae413ab1d4798c6440c7306137fb462ea0181fc281774734666461
1 Input
1 Output
-
01020c1d94ae413ab1d4798c6440c7306137fb462ea0181fc281774734666461:0
- value
- 503487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f08f163bf24199573e2aef3c2144a8350b396540 OP_EQUAL
- address
- 3PcyWRzxV3ybGtpLQVJpDaqn1LLb32uC2a